
KI-PHD
The KI-PHD detector brings advanced multisensor technology to a practical design that increases efficiency, saves installation time, cuts costs, and extends life safety and property protection capabilities. Continuous self-diagnostics ensure reliability over the long-haul, while environmental compensation helps reduce main tenance costs.

Application
- Smoke detection
The KI-PHD detects extremely small particles of combustion and
triggers an alarm at the first sign of smoke. Thanks to its high
performance forward-scattering reflective response technology,
the photoelectric smoke sensor responds quickly and reliably to
a wide range of fire types, espe cially slow burning fires fuelled by
combustibles typically found in modern multi-use buildings.
